Effectively Wild Episode 1546: Best of the Best

Ben Lindbergh and Sam Miller banter about viral particles, Mike Trout’s self-identified best at-bat, Carney Lansford’s possible link to Sir Francis Drake, sports card “breakers,” a perplexing story involving Ty Cobb and Honus Wagner, Wilbert Robinson’s five birthdays, why a love of playing baseball often translates to a love of anything connected to baseball, the serendipitous discoveries that come from browsing newspaper archives, and a mysterious 1989 Cy Young vote.
